Definition and Purpose of Hive Scales

Beehive scales are an essential tool for beekeepers to monitor and manage their beehives. They allow beekeepers to accurately weigh the nectar and pollen stored by the bees within the hive. This information is crucial in determining the overall health of the colony, as it provides insight into the foraging efficiency and food storage capacity.

The concept of beehive scales has been around for centuries, with early records dating back to ancient Egypt. However, modern beekeeping has seen significant advancements in technology, leading to more sophisticated and user-friendly scale systems.

Beehive scales serve several purposes for beekeepers. Firstly, they help monitor the colony’s growth rate by tracking the weight gain or loss over time. This information can be used to make informed decisions regarding feedings, treatments, and other management practices. Secondly, beehive scales allow beekeepers to detect issues such as queen failure, disease, or pests earlier on, thereby preventing significant losses.

It is not uncommon for a strong colony to store around 60-80 pounds of honey per year. By accurately weighing the stored nectar and pollen, beekeepers can determine if their colonies are thriving.

Types of Hive Scales: Manual vs. Digital

When it comes to monitoring the weight of your beehive, you have two main options: manual hive scales and digital hive scales. Both types have their advantages and disadvantages, which we’ll explore below.

Manual hive scales are a traditional choice for beekeepers. They’re often made of sturdy materials like metal or plastic and consist of a series of weights that can be added or removed to measure the hive’s weight. While manual scales are cost-effective and easy to use, they may not provide accurate readings, especially if you’re measuring in small increments. Furthermore, manual scales require more maintenance than digital models since the weights need to be recalibrated periodically.

Digital hive scales, on the other hand, offer greater accuracy and ease of use. They can display precise weight measurements in real-time and often come with additional features like data logging and alarm notifications. However, digital scales are typically pricier than manual ones, and their batteries may need to be replaced or recharged regularly. Ultimately, whether you choose a manual or digital hive scale depends on your specific needs and budget.

To give you a better idea of the cost difference between manual and digital hive scales: manual models can start as low as $50-$70, while high-end digital models can range from $200 to over $1,000.

Factors to Consider: Size, Portability, and Ease of Use

When choosing the right beehive scale for your apiary, several key factors come into play. Let’s start with size – a crucial consideration that often gets overlooked. A scale that’s too small may not accommodate the full hive, while one that’s excessively large can be cumbersome and take up valuable space in your apiary.

Consider the portability of the scale as well. If you have multiple hives scattered across your property or plan to move them frequently for monitoring or harvesting purposes, a lightweight, compact scale is essential. Some models come with built-in carrying handles or wheels, making it easier to transport the hive without straining your back.

Lastly, ease of use should not be underestimated. A user-friendly interface and clear display can make all the difference in accurately tracking weight fluctuations and making informed decisions about your colony’s health. Look for a scale with intuitive controls, a backlit display, or even Bluetooth connectivity for seamless data transfer to your smartphone or computer. By considering these factors, you’ll find a beehive scale that perfectly complements your apiary operations.

Maintaining Your Hive Scale: Regular Checks and Cleaning

Regular maintenance is crucial to ensure that your beehive scale provides accurate readings and extends its lifespan. Without proper care, your scale may become inaccurate or even malfunction, which can lead to poor decision-making when it comes to managing your apiary.

To maintain your hive scale, start by checking the calibration regularly. This should be done at least once a month, but ideally every week during peak honey production periods. Use a reference weight to ensure that the scale is reading accurately. If you notice any discrepancies, consult the manufacturer’s instructions for recalibration procedures.

Cleaning the scale is also essential. Food particles and debris can accumulate on the surface and affect readings. Use a soft-bristled brush or a damp cloth to gently remove any dirt or grime. Pay particular attention to the weighing platform and any other areas where food may collect.

Regular maintenance will not only ensure accurate readings but also extend the lifespan of your beehive scale. A well-maintained scale can last for many years, providing valuable insights into your bee colony‘s health and productivity. By incorporating regular checks and cleaning into your apiary routine, you’ll be able to make informed decisions about your bees’ needs and optimize their performance.
